Alan Ling Calls for Strengthened Local Waste Management and Strict Law Enforcement to Tackle Littering

Published at Jan 09, 2025 01:32 pm
(Miri, 9th) Sarawak's Democratic Action Party Secretary Alan Ling recently received multiple complaints from the public about the Emart Commercial Center in Miri riam, where a mountain of garbage has accumulated, emitting a severe stench, and seriously harming the health of passersby and the city's appearance. He immediately visited the site for inspection and found the situation far worse than expected. The scale of the garbage pile not only affects the surrounding environment but also brings great inconvenience and distress to citizens.

On-site, he stated that the foul odor from the garbage has spread to the surrounding areas, forcing passersby, especially children and the elderly, to cover their noses. Exposure to such harsh environments could lead to various health issues. Additionally, the garbage pile severely affects the city's appearance, leaving a very poor impression and damaging the community's image.

He plainly stated that this situation is clearly an unignorable public health issue, and the municipal council and relevant departments must immediately take action to ensure the living environment of citizens is protected. He urged the municipal council to set up regulated garbage stations or large trash bins in bustling commercial areas and residential zones, so merchants and residents can properly handle their waste and demanded that the council must clean regularly to avoid prolonged garbage accumulation in public areas.

Furthermore, he suggested that the municipal council should increase the enforcement of laws and take strict measures against offenders, as a clean cityscape is a basic responsibility of all citizens, which requires a high level of civic-mindedness.

He emphasized that "the garbage issue is not just an environmental problem, but a public health problem as well. We cannot sit idly by; practical measures must be taken to protect the interests of citizens and the image of Miri city."

Alan Ling stated that the Democratic Action Party of Sarawak will continue to monitor and oversee the municipal council's efforts in environmental hygiene improvements to ensure that Miri city becomes a cleaner and more livable city.
